Transaction 51515789abb0f40d4fb05d0bd05c576a126d499c34fdf1d2f677ccfa7860a70a
1 Input
1 Output
-
51515789abb0f40d4fb05d0bd05c576a126d499c34fdf1d2f677ccfa7860a70a:0
- value
- 1856404
- script pubkey
- OP_0 OP_PUSHBYTES_20 45a06bd59a3a4a1331f2d15f7c37f74a3b8b877f
- address
- bc1qgksxh4v68f9pxv0j690hcdlhfgachpml4r8cv8